import ifcopenshell
def add_context_dependent_unit(
file: ifcopenshell.file,
unit_type: str = "USERDEFINED",
name: str = "THINGAMAJIG",
dimensions: tuple[int, int, int, int, int, int, int] = (0, 0, 0, 0, 0, 0, 0),
) -> ifcopenshell.entity_instance:
"""Add a new arbitrary unit that can only be interpreted in a project specific context
Occasionally the construction industry uses arbitrary units to quantify
objects, like "pairs" of door hardware, "palettes" or "boxes" of fixings
or equipment.
:param unit_type: Typically should be left as USERDEFINED, unless for
some bizarre reason you are redefining something you could use a
sensible normal unit for. In that case, firstly stop whatever you're
doing and have a hard think about your life, and then if life really
is going that badly for you, check out the IFC docs for IfcUnitEnum.
:type unit_type: str
:param name: Give your unit a name. X what? X bananas?
:type name: str
:param dimensions: Units typically measure one of 7 fundamental physical
dimensions: length, mass, time, electric current, temperature,
substance amount, or luminous intensity. These are represented as a
list of 7 integers, representing the exponents of each one of these
dimensions. For example, a length unit is (1, 0, 0, 0, 0, 0, 0),
where as an area unit is (2, 0, 0, 0, 0, 0, 0). A unit of meters per
second is (1, 0, -1, 0, 0, 0, 0). For context dependent units, it is
recommended to leave this as the default of (0, 0, 0, 0, 0, 0, 0).
:type dimensions: list[int]
:return: The new IfcContextDependentUnit
:rtype: ifcopenshell.entity_instance
Example:
.. code:: python
# Boxes of things
ifcopenshell.api.unit.add_context_dependent_unit(model, name="BOXES")
"""
settings = {"unit_type": unit_type, "name": name, "dimensions": dimensions}
return file.create_entity(
"IfcContextDependentUnit",
Dimensions=file.createIfcDimensionalExponents(*settings["dimensions"]),
UnitType=settings["unit_type"],
Name=settings["name"],
)
